diff --git a/fs/libfs.c b/fs/libfs.c
index 65e1feca8b98..88a4cb418756 100644
--- a/fs/libfs.c
+++ b/fs/libfs.c
@@ -1108,3 +1108,98 @@ const struct inode_operations simple_symlink_inode_operations = {
.readlink = generic_readlink
};
EXPORT_SYMBOL(simple_symlink_inode_operations);
+
+/*
+ * Operations for a permanently empty directory.
+ */
+static struct dentry *empty_dir_lookup(struct inode *dir, struct dentry *dentry, unsigned int flags)
+{
+ return ERR_PTR(-ENOENT);
+}
+
+static int empty_dir_getattr(struct vfsmount *mnt, struct dentry *dentry,
+ struct kstat *stat)
+{
+ struct inode *inode = d_inode(dentry);
+ generic_fillattr(inode, stat);
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static int empty_dir_setattr(struct dentry *dentry, struct iattr *attr)
+{
+ return -EPERM;
+}
+
+static int empty_dir_setxattr(struct dentry *dentry, const char *name,
+ const void *value, size_t size, int flags)
+{
+ return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+}
+
+static ssize_t empty_dir_getxattr(struct dentry *dentry, const char *name,
+ void *value, size_t size)
+{
+ return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+}
+
+static int empty_dir_removexattr(struct dentry *dentry, const char *name)
+{
+ return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+}
+
+static ssize_t empty_dir_listxattr(struct dentry *dentry, char *list, size_t size)
+{
+ return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+}
+
+static const struct inode_operations empty_dir_inode_operations = {
+ .lookup = empty_dir_lookup,
+ .permission = generic_permission,
+ .setattr = empty_dir_setattr,
+ .getattr = empty_dir_getattr,
+ .setxattr = empty_dir_setxattr,
+ .getxattr = empty_dir_getxattr,
+ .removexattr = empty_dir_removexattr,
+ .listxattr = empty_dir_listxattr,
+};
+
+static loff_t empty_dir_llseek(struct file *file, loff_t offset, int whence)
+{
+ /* An empty directory has two entries . and .. at offsets 0 and 1 */
+ return generic_file_llseek_size(file, offset, whence, 2, 2);
+}
+
+static int empty_dir_readdir(struct file *file, struct dir_context *ctx)
+{
+ dir_emit_dots(file, ctx);
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static const struct file_operations empty_dir_operations = {
+ .llseek = empty_dir_llseek,
+ .read = generic_read_dir,
+ .iterate = empty_dir_readdir,
+ .fsync = noop_fsync,
+};
+
+
+void make_empty_dir_inode(struct inode *inode)
+{
+ set_nlink(inode, 2);
+ inode->i_mode = S_IFDIR | S_IRUGO | S_IXUGO;
+ inode->i_uid = GLOBAL_ROOT_UID;
+ inode->i_gid = GLOBAL_ROOT_GID;
+ inode->i_rdev = 0;
+ inode->i_size = 2;
+ inode->i_blkbits = PAGE_SHIFT;
+ inode->i_blocks = 0;
+
+ inode->i_op = &empty_dir_inode_operations;
+ inode->i_fop = &empty_dir_operations;
+}
+
+bool is_empty_dir_inode(struct inode *inode)
+{
+ return (inode->i_fop == &empty_dir_operations) &&
+ (inode->i_op == &empty_dir_inode_operations);
+}
